Robotics & AGV Systems

The San Francisco Bay Area is home to the world's most dense concentration of autonomous mobile robots (AMRs), robotic arms, and delivery rovers. These applications require high torque density, accurate encoder feedback, and high efficiency to extend battery life in the field. Custom gearboxes integrated with low-voltage DC motors power everything from joint actuation to active sensor cleaning assemblies.

Biotechnology & MedTech

From South San Francisco lab automation startups to established instrumentation giants, micro-drive components are critical. Centrifuges, liquid handling workstations, peristaltic pumps, and diagnostic equipment depend on precision motors with low electromagnetic interference (EMI) profiles, low noise outputs, and clean operation to ensure precise biological assay performance.

Brushless BLDC Transition

While conventional coreless brushed motors remain extremely efficient for short-duty-cycle consumer goods, global industrial and medical sectors are rapidly transitioning to Brushless DC (BLDC) systems. BLDC topologies eliminate mechanical brush wear, ensuring a service life span limited only by high-speed ball-bearing wear.

What is the advantage of using carbon brushes versus metal brushes in micro motors?
Metal brushes are ideal for low-voltage, lower-speed applications requiring low starting friction. Carbon brushes handle higher continuous current loads, offer better self-lubrication, and provide longer service life under high-speed and high-torque conditions.
